Admissions Testing and Course Placement
All degree-seeking and non-degree seeking students requesting to register in a math or English course, are required to complete an assessment of academic abilities prior to enrollment. This requirement can be fulfilled in one of the following ways:
Complete a pre-enrollment placement exam through Northeast’s Testing Center.
Provide current ACT, SAT, Accuplacer, or MAP scores.
Submit an official college transcript demonstrating successful (“C” grade or better) completion of a college-level English and/or math course. Placement test scores and previous college transcripts must be on file in the Admission and Registration Office prior to class registration. Scores and transcripts will be reviewed during advisement and used to determine appropriate levels of coursework.
If students do not have current placement test scores and have not successfully completed a college-level English or math course, a pre-enrollment assessment will be administered at the Norfolk campus or any of Northeast’s extended campus locations. Distance learning students who cannot access testing services at these locations need to arrange for testing at a site near them and transfer their scores to Northeast.
